What PPC Costs
It really is entirely up to you how much you choose to pay. All else being equal, the more you bid per click the higher your ads get shown in the search results. Obviously the thing to bear in mind here is that you don't set a maximum CPC (cost-per-click) higher than what you think it's worth. For example if your website is selling a product for £5, it is crazy to bid £5 for a click because it's impossible to obtain a conversion rate of 100%!
Conversely if you end up bidding too low, your ads may never get shown at all and so the click volume will be heavily affected. The PPC costs also very much depend on the market in which you are operating. For example buying clicks for a freebies website is going to be cheaper than the cost of keywords based around solicitors.
